Understanding Kids Scooter Helmet Laws


As the popularity of scooter riding among children continues to rise, so does the need for safety measures to protect young riders. One of the most crucial aspects of this safety is the proper use of helmets. While many parents advocate for helmet use, laws regarding helmet requirements for children riding scooters vary widely across different regions. This article delves into the importance of these laws, their variations, and the implications for child safety.


The Importance of Helmet Use


Helmets are vital protective gear for anyone riding a scooter, especially children. According to various studies, wearing a helmet significantly reduces the risk of head injuries during falls or collisions.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) reports that wearing a helmet can lower the risk of head injury by 85%. For children, whose bodies and brains are still developing, adhering to safety regulations regarding helmet use is paramount.


Existing Helmet Laws


Helmet laws differ not only by country but also by state and municipality. In the United States, for example, some states have stringent laws mandating that children under a certain age must wear helmets while riding scooters. California’s law, for instance, requires all riders under the age of 18 to wear a helmet when using a scooter. On the other hand, states like Texas have more relaxed regulations, leaving it to parents to decide whether their children should wear helmets.


Moreover, some cities within states can impose their own rules. For instance, in New York City, all riders under the age of 18 must wear a helmet when riding a scooter, regardless of state laws. This patchwork of regulations can confuse parents trying to ensure their children’s safety, emphasizing the need for clear and consistent safety laws.


The Debate Around Helmet Laws

While many parents support mandatory helmet laws as a way to protect children, some argue against them. Opponents of these regulations often claim that forced helmet usage may discourage children from engaging in outdoor activities such as scooter riding, which in turn can hinder their physical activity levels. They argue that a balanced approach, focusing on teaching children safe riding practices rather than solely enforcing helmet laws, might be more effective.


However, proponents of helmet laws counter this argument by emphasizing that safety should always come first. They highlight how the presence of laws requiring helmet use can foster a culture of safety among young riders and their families. By normalizing helmet usage, children may be more likely to view it as a necessary part of riding, rather than an impediment to their fun.


Educating Parents and Children


Regardless of the existing laws, education plays a crucial role in ensuring child safety while riding scooters. Parents should be encouraged to educate their children about the importance of helmet use and safe riding practices. Schools and community organizations can also play a pivotal role by organizing events that promote safe riding, helmet giveaways, and educational workshops focusing on safe scooting behavior.


The Future of Kids Scooter Helmet Laws


As scooter riding continues to grow in popularity, it is likely that helmet laws for children will evolve. Advocacy groups are pushing for more comprehensive laws that prioritize the safety of young riders across the board. This may include broader public awareness campaigns and initiatives aimed at educating both parents and children on the importance of wearing helmets, regardless of legal requirements.


In conclusion, while the laws regarding children's helmet use while riding scooters differ significantly, the undeniable importance of helmet safety remains constant. Regardless of regional laws, parents should prioritize safety by ensuring their children wear helmets while riding scooters. As communities work towards creating safer environments for young riders, embracing helmet use could lead to a healthier, safer next generation of scooter enthusiasts.
